Как использовать функцию strconv в VBA Excel

Структурированная Visual Basic для приложений (VBA) предоставляет различные функции для обработки данных в Microsoft Excel. Одной из таких полезных функций является StrConv, которая позволяет преобразовывать текст в различные форматы. В этой статье мы рассмотрим, как использовать функцию StrConv для преобразования текста в Excel.

Функция StrConv имеет следующий синтаксис:

StrConv(выражение, преобразование_тип)

Выражение — это текст или строка, которую вы хотите преобразовать. Преобразование_тип — это тип преобразования, который вы хотите применить к тексту. Вот некоторые распространенные типы преобразования:

  • vbUpperCase — преобразует текст в верхний регистр.
  • vbLowerCase — преобразует текст в нижний регистр.
  • vbProperCase — преобразует каждое слово текста так, чтобы первая буква была в верхнем регистре.
  • vbWide — преобразует символы полуширины в символы широты.
  • vbNarrow — преобразует символы ширины в символы полуширины.

Давайте рассмотрим примеры использования функции StrConv.

Пример 1. Преобразование текста в верхний регистр:

Допустим, у нас есть ячейка A1 со значением «Hello, World!». Мы хотим преобразовать этот текст в верхний регистр. Мы можем использовать следующую формулу:

=StrConv(A1, vbUpperCase)

Результат будет «HELLO, WORLD!».

Пример 2. Преобразование текста в нижний регистр:

Пусть ячейка A1 содержит значение «Hello, World!». Чтобы преобразовать этот текст в нижний регистр, мы можем использовать формулу:

=StrConv(A1, vbLowerCase)

Результатом будет «hello, world!».

Пример 3. Преобразование текста в Proper Case:

Допустим, у нас есть ячейка A1 со значением «hello, world!». Чтобы преобразовать этот текст в Proper Case, где первая буква каждого слова будет в верхнем регистре, мы можем использовать формулу:

=StrConv(A1, vbProperCase)

Результат будет «Hello, World!».

Таким образом, функция StrConv является мощным инструментом для преобразования текста в различные форматы в Excel. Эта функция может быть полезна при работе с базами данных, создании отчетов или просто при редактировании текста в ячейках Excel. Вы можете использовать различные типы преобразования, чтобы достичь желаемого результата и сделать свою работу более эффективной.

Читайте также:  Установить vaio control center windows 10
Оцените статью